"Kerry just conceded. I expected better from him. This whole election stinks.
Be optimistic, Dad--I know it's hard, it's hard for me, too. Their arguments change, but in the end, the GOP wants to stop the world from changing, and if there's one thing we know, it's that the world will change. Our country is getting more diverse, not less; more urban, not less; more global, not less. The GOP can rig elections and slice and dice the electorate all they want, but these are forces they can't control. This is why they're cozy with the end-of-the-worlders--they realize that their time is nearly over.
Bush may well be what he thinks he is--an instrument of God--but not in the way he believes. Wisdom--or if you like, God's grace--does not come without pain. We had to have a Civil War to have freedom; we had to have WWI to get votes for women; we had to have a Great Depression to get Social Security; we had to have WWII to have a UN. There is no Martin Luther King without Jim Crow. History shows this: our loving, accepting God is bigger than Bush's hating and punishing God.
We will win, because it's not about winning. It's about being our best selves, and our actions during this election were in harmony with that. The others will come around--the world is working on them, too. Our job is to be firm, clear, and above all, still here to show a more hopeful alternative. Sooner or later, it will fall to people like us to point the way up and out, and when it does, we need to be ready."
